1. Rub the venison with salt and allspice, then with tomato paste on all sides.
2. To the pressure cooker, add the venison, broth, vinegar, rosemary, garlic cloves, and bay leaves. Add enough water so that it covers the venison by at least 3 inches.
3. Set to pressure cook on high for 60 minutes. Do a quick release when finished.
4. While the venison cooks, peel and cube the potatoes into 2 inch pieces. Add the carrots and potatoes to the pressure cooker when the initial 60 minutes is finished. Stir, pushing the venison under the broth if it's become uncovered. Seal the lid and pressure cook again on high for 10 minutes. Quick release when finished.

1. Press the Sauté button on your 6- or 8-quart Instant Pot and let it heat up for about two minutes. Combine the beef, garlic, and onion in the post and sauté for 3 minutes, using a wooden spoon or spatula to move the beef around so it browns on all sides.
2. Cancel the Sauté function and add the dried thyme, zucchini, carrots, fennel, and broth. Stir to combine.
3. Lock on the lid, select the Pressure Cook function, and adjust to high pressure for 30 minutes. Make sure the steam valve is set in the “Sealing”
4. When the cooking time is up, let the pressure come down naturally for 10 minutes before using the quick release to unlock the lid.
